Molecular engineering of liquid crystalline polymers by living polymerization

21. Synthesis and characterization of poly{3-[(4-cyano-4′-biphenyl)oxy]propyl vinyl ether} macromonomers

Summary

This paper describes the synthesis and characterization of poly{3-[4-cyano-4′-biphenyl)oxy]propyl vinyl ether} [poly(6-3)] macromonomers obtained by the functionalization of the growing chain end of the corresponding living polymer obtained by the initiation of the cationic polymerization of 3-[4-cyano-4′-biphenyl)oxy]propyl vinyl ether with CF3SO3H/S(CH3)2, with 2-hydroxy ethyl methacrylate [poly(6-3)-I], 2-[2-(2-allyloxyethoxy)ethoxy]ethanol [poly(6-3)-II] and 10-undecen-1-ol [poly(6-3)-III].
